From mboxrd@z Thu Jan 1 00:00:00 1970 From: Jeremy Fitzhardinge Subject: Re: latest xen/master 2.6.31.5 32bit dom0 kernel build fails in xen_create_msi_irq Date: Mon, 09 Nov 2009 16:22:10 -0800 Message-ID: <4AF8B232.7040308@goop.org> References: <20091108200551.GU1434@reaktio.net> Mime-Version: 1.0 Content-Type: text/plain; charset=ISO-8859-1 Content-Transfer-Encoding: quoted-printable Return-path: In-Reply-To: <20091108200551.GU1434@reaktio.net> List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, Sender: xen-devel-bounces@lists.xensource.com Errors-To: xen-devel-bounces@lists.xensource.com To: =?ISO-8859-1?Q?Pasi_K=E4rkk=E4inen?= Cc: xen-devel@lists.xensource.com, Konrad Rzeszutek Wilk List-Id: xen-devel@lists.xenproject.org On 11/08/09 12:05, Pasi K=E4rkk=E4inen wrote: > Hello, > > Latest 2.6.31.5 xen/master tree fails to build on 32bit: > > drivers/xen/events.c: In function 'xen_create_msi_irq': > drivers/xen/events.c:725: error: too many arguments to function 'pci_fr= ontend_enable_msi' > make[2]: *** [drivers/xen/events.o] Error 1 > make[1]: *** [drivers/xen] Error 2 > > The line in question is: > rc =3D pci_frontend_enable_msi(dev, &pirq); > > With quick searching and grepping I could find pci_frontend_enable_msi(= ) function definition from anywhere.. > =20 Should be fixed now. J